diff options
author | Prabhu Ramachandran | 2018-06-07 16:14:37 +0530 |
---|---|---|
committer | GitHub | 2018-06-07 16:14:37 +0530 |
commit | 4eb754c2e71922819de7390d1b4993a21763de3e (patch) | |
tree | fede3f4250f3711d31da4bb7edd262edd0a90727 /yaksh/evaluator_tests/test_scilab_evaluation.py | |
parent | 78ce1804d3a82327aa0da1510bb5c03d6bbff3ba (diff) | |
parent | 93bb10eae5e1364ae6492f2534f0e7864c9c4254 (diff) | |
download | online_test-4eb754c2e71922819de7390d1b4993a21763de3e.tar.gz online_test-4eb754c2e71922819de7390d1b4993a21763de3e.tar.bz2 online_test-4eb754c2e71922819de7390d1b4993a21763de3e.zip |
Merge pull request #482 from adityacp/pep8_changes
Pep8 changes
Diffstat (limited to 'yaksh/evaluator_tests/test_scilab_evaluation.py')
-rw-r--r-- | yaksh/evaluator_tests/test_scilab_evaluation.py | 27 |
1 files changed, 11 insertions, 16 deletions
diff --git a/yaksh/evaluator_tests/test_scilab_evaluation.py b/yaksh/evaluator_tests/test_scilab_evaluation.py index f7a9925..d3f1dc8 100644 --- a/yaksh/evaluator_tests/test_scilab_evaluation.py +++ b/yaksh/evaluator_tests/test_scilab_evaluation.py @@ -6,12 +6,12 @@ import tempfile from psutil import Process from textwrap import dedent -#Local Import +# Local Import from yaksh import grader as gd from yaksh.grader import Grader -from yaksh.scilab_code_evaluator import ScilabCodeEvaluator from yaksh.evaluator_tests.test_python_evaluation import EvaluatorBaseTest + class ScilabEvaluationTestCases(EvaluatorBaseTest): def setUp(self): tmp_in_dir_path = tempfile.mkdtemp() @@ -54,7 +54,7 @@ class ScilabEvaluationTestCases(EvaluatorBaseTest): self.file_paths = None gd.SERVER_TIMEOUT = 9 self.timeout_msg = ("Code took more than {0} seconds to run. " - "You probably have an infinite loop" + "You probably have an infinite loop" " in your code.").format(gd.SERVER_TIMEOUT) def tearDown(self): @@ -63,15 +63,14 @@ class ScilabEvaluationTestCases(EvaluatorBaseTest): def test_correct_answer(self): user_answer = ("funcprot(0)\nfunction[c]=add(a,b)" - "\n\tc=a+b;\nendfunction") + "\n\tc=a+b;\nendfunction") kwargs = { 'metadata': { 'user_answer': user_answer, 'file_paths': self.file_paths, 'partial_grading': False, 'language': 'scilab' - }, - 'test_case_data': self.test_case_data, + }, 'test_case_data': self.test_case_data, } grader = Grader(self.in_dir) @@ -81,15 +80,14 @@ class ScilabEvaluationTestCases(EvaluatorBaseTest): def test_error(self): user_answer = ("funcprot(0)\nfunction[c]=add(a,b)" - "\n\tc=a+b;\ndis(\tendfunction") + "\n\tc=a+b;\ndis(\tendfunction") kwargs = { 'metadata': { 'user_answer': user_answer, 'file_paths': self.file_paths, 'partial_grading': False, 'language': 'scilab' - }, - 'test_case_data': self.test_case_data, + }, 'test_case_data': self.test_case_data, } grader = Grader(self.in_dir) @@ -98,18 +96,16 @@ class ScilabEvaluationTestCases(EvaluatorBaseTest): self.assertFalse(result.get("success")) self.assert_correct_output('error', result.get("error")) - def test_incorrect_answer(self): user_answer = ("funcprot(0)\nfunction[c]=add(a,b)" - "\n\tc=a-b;\nendfunction") + "\n\tc=a-b;\nendfunction") kwargs = { 'metadata': { 'user_answer': user_answer, 'file_paths': self.file_paths, 'partial_grading': False, 'language': 'scilab' - }, - 'test_case_data': self.test_case_data, + }, 'test_case_data': self.test_case_data, } grader = Grader(self.in_dir) @@ -122,15 +118,14 @@ class ScilabEvaluationTestCases(EvaluatorBaseTest): def test_infinite_loop(self): user_answer = ("funcprot(0)\nfunction[c]=add(a,b)" - "\n\tc=a;\nwhile(1==1)\nend\nendfunction") + "\n\tc=a;\nwhile(1==1)\nend\nendfunction") kwargs = { 'metadata': { 'user_answer': user_answer, 'file_paths': self.file_paths, 'partial_grading': False, 'language': 'scilab' - }, - 'test_case_data': self.test_case_data, + }, 'test_case_data': self.test_case_data, } grader = Grader(self.in_dir) |